Victor Figueroa moved all in from the button for about 975,000, and Marco Townsend called from the big blind with .
Figueroa turned over , and he needed to improve to stay alive.
The board came , and Townsend flops a set of sixes to win the pot and eliminate Figueroa in third place.
Victor Figueroa – Eliminated in 3rd Place ($27,605)
And here are the approximate chip counts for the start of heads-up play:
Marco Townsend – 2,975,000 (50 bb)
Nelson Resendiz – 1,375,000 (23 bb)
